【SQL229】题解 | 使用子查询的方式找出属于Action分类的所有电影对应的title等

使用子查询的方式找出属于Action分类的所有电影对应的title,description

https://www.nowcoder.com/practice/2f2e556d335d469f96b91b212c4c203e

/*
在category表里面由电影分类名称name得到电影分类idcategory_id
在film_category表里面由电影分类idcategory_id得到电影idfilm_id
在film表里面由电影idfilm_id得到电影名称title和电影描述信息description
*/
/*
select
    f.title, f.description
from 
    film f
    join film_category fc on f.film_id = fc.film_id
    join category c on fc.category_id = c.category_id
where c.name = 'Action';
--非子查询思路
*/

select 
    title, description /*查询到电影名称和电影描述*/
from
    film
where
    film_id 
    in(
        select film_id from film_category fc join category c on fc.category_id = c.category_id
        where c.name = 'Action');/*使用子查询查询到符合条件的电影编号idfilm_id

参考链接:https://zhuanlan.zhihu.com/p/43873518

https://blog.csdn.net/vaivxuanzi/article/details/124796208

SQL学习专栏 文章被收录于专栏

发个sql学习和实践的小记录

全部评论

相关推荐

再懒也要睡懒觉:大学4年玩的挺爽的哈😅
点赞 评论 收藏
分享
评论
点赞
收藏
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务